Hunger Awareness Banquet to Raise Funds and Education

Last October, Fort Hays State University students and other volunteers packaged over 20,000 meals that were sent to the Horn of Africa. The group now is raising money for a huge expansion of that SWIPE Out Hunger event.

The Global Leadership Project is hosting a Hunger Awareness Banquet to both raise funds for next fall’s project and to educate those in attendance about the realities of hunger in the world. Student Coordinator Kelly Nuckolls says some attendees will receive a three-course meal and others will get the pre-packaged meals.

The group is working to raise enough funds to be able to package 100,000 meals next October. The banquet and silent auction will be March 2nd at 6:30 at the Robbins Center. RSVP by February 28th by emailing [email protected].
